Intel

Core i9-14901E

The Core i9-14901E is manufactured by Intel. It was released in Julho 2024 (1 year ago). It is based on the Raptor Lake-R (2023−2025) architecture. It features 8 cores and 16 threads. Base frequency is 2.8 GHz, with boost up to 5.6 GHz. L3 cache: 36 MB (total). L2 cache: 2 MB (per core). Built on 10 nm process technology. Socket: LGA1700. Thermal design power (TDP): 65 Watt. Memory support: DDR4, DDR5. Passmark benchmark score: 30,298 points. Launch price was $499.

Intel

Core i7-12700

The Core i7-12700 is manufactured by Intel. It was released in Janeiro 2022 (3 years ago). It is based on the Alder Lake-S (2022) architecture. It features 12 cores and 20 threads. Base frequency is 2.1 GHz, with boost up to 4.9 GHz. L3 cache: 25 MB (total). L2 cache: 1.25 MB (per core). Built on Intel 7 nm process technology. Socket: LGA1700. Thermal design power (TDP): 65 Watt. Memory support: DDR5-4800, DDR4-3200. Passmark benchmark score: 30,055 points. Launch price was $349.

Processing Power

The Core i9-14901E packs 8 cores / 16 threads, while the Core i7-12700 offers 12 cores / 20 threads — the Core i7-12700 has 4 more cores. Boost clocks reach 5.6 GHz on the Core i9-14901E versus 4.9 GHz on the Core i7-12700 — a 13.3% clock advantage for the Core i9-14901E (base: 2.8 GHz vs 2.1 GHz). The Core i9-14901E uses the Raptor Lake-R (2023−2025) architecture (10 nm), while the Core i7-12700 uses Alder Lake-S (2022) (Intel 7 nm). In PassMark, the Core i9-14901E scores 30,298 against the Core i7-12700's 30,055 — a 0.8% lead for the Core i9-14901E. Geekbench 6 single-core — the metric most relevant to gaming — records 2,894 vs 2,497, a 14.7% lead for the Core i9-14901E that directly translates to higher frame rates. Multi-core Geekbench: 14,262 vs 12,448 (13.6% advantage for the Core i9-14901E). L3 cache: 36 MB (total) on the Core i9-14901E vs 25 MB (total) on the Core i7-12700.

Memory & Platform

Both processors use the LGA1700 socket with PCIe 5.0. Both support up to DDR5-5600 memory speed. The Core i9-14901E supports up to 192 GB of RAM compared to 128 GB 40% more capacity for professional workloads. Both feature 2-channel memory with ECC support. Both provide 20 PCIe lanes. Chipset compatibility: Intel 600 Series,Intel 700 Series (Core i9-14901E) and H610,B660,H670,Z690,B760,Z790 (Core i7-12700).
